Wet n Wild by Deb Pulford (CT)
SB #1 Kraft & 2 (Blue & Yellow)
I have chosen yellow and blue as my 2 colours to go with the Kraft.  I created a collage of pics from Wet n Wild and heavily inked the edges Pinecone versacolor (my absolute favourite), as well as the edges of the Kraft cardstock. The chippie alphas were embossed with Yellow Spark embossing powder, and I have used Liquid Pearls and a Broken China Distressing glue for the 'dots' on the layout. I have also splatterd Glimmer Mist in Jazz Blue and Sunflower.
Well done Deb, very minimalistic and clean,  with the colours in your multi photo layout a bright contrast.
